Adhd in Adults Symptoms

Adhd in adults is a condition that alters how a person thinks, behaves and responds to various situations. If you suffer from ADHD it could be difficult to focus on tasks, which can make it hard to complete tasks on time. It could also result in the loss of productivity. Distractions

Attention deficit hyperactivity disorder (ADHD) is a condition that affects both children and adults. It impacts the quality of life of the sufferers due to the fact that it makes it difficult for them to complete tasks on a day to day basis. ADHD can cause issues with concentration, impulsivity, and signs And Symptoms of adhd in women many other problems.

ADHD is the most prevalent reason for attention problems. ADHD is an illness of the brain that affects the ways information is processed in the brain.

This article will explore the distracting factors and the impact of distractions on an adult suffering from ADHD. External and internal distractions are also possible. External distractions are caused by external causes like noise and other outside stimuli. Internal distractions are usually the result of poor organizational skills and other mental health problems.

ADHD patients may experience difficulty working on a project or organizing a file system. They might also be distracted and putting off important tasks. A supportive manager or co-worker can be a great help.

To stay clear of distractions, ADHD adults can keep a list of tasks. This can help them stay on the track of their tasks and prevent them from forgetting. They can also wear noise cancellation headphones to block out the distractions from sounds around.

Procrastination

ADHD sufferers tend to be more procrastinators than other people. The condition can affect the productivity, work quality, and relationships. There are many ways to deal with procrastination, including cognitive behavior therapy and Occupational therapy.

Procrastination is eliminated by breaking down the task into smaller pieces. Smaller steps can reduce the stress and anxiety that can result in procrastination. Setting a deadline can aid you in completing the task.

If you need help dealing procrastination, a licensed mental health professional will give the guidance you need. They can assist you to create productive habits, change your negative thoughts, and also teach methods for managing your time. These skills will allow you to finish the job.

Aspects of ADHD medication

Many adults who suffer from Attention deficit hyperactivity disorder (ADHD) have experienced adverse side effects that are associated with their medications. These side effects can impact short-term and long-term outcomes. In particular, adverse events can significantly impact quality of life.

Researchers conducted a survey on a vast group of people who are receiving ADHD medications to assess the adverse effects on their lives. More than half of the participants experienced adverse events.

Most commonly reported side effects were sleep problems, including insomnia and other sleep disturbances. Some participants also reported feeling less hungry. The rebound effect is a common adverse effect of stimulants with short-acting properties. It may be best to overlap doses or change to a formulation that has a longer acting effect.

Depression, anxiety, panic attacks, and other symptoms are also common. Participants reported having at least one symptom from each of these three categories in the month prior to the data collection. They also stated that each of the symptoms had a negative impact on their overall health and well-being. Additionally each of the three symptoms was associated with the result of a 1.6-point reduction in the AAQoL score.

Diagnosis

ADHD is a well-known mental disorder that triggers symptoms like impulsivity or inattention. It can affect both adults and children. The symptoms may include compulsive behavior, substance abuse, and anxiety.

The condition usually manifests itself in the early years of childhood. ADHD sufferers usually have difficulty managing their responsibilities, such finishing school assignments or caring for the household. They might also struggle with relationships or career problems.

It is recommended to consult a doctor if you suspect that you may suffer from ADHD. This person will examine your family, yourself, and your current symptoms. You may be required to take a psychological test. These tests will assess your thinking ability, working memory, executive functioning, and executive functioning.

A specialist will also require school records from your childhood. These records together with other information from your family and you will be used by your health care professional to diagnose the illness.

When you get a diagnosis it is then possible to learn about your treatment options. Treatment may include medication and therapy. The most common treatment is medication. Nonstimulant drugs can be used as an alternative treatment.

Adults with ADHD will often seek diagnosis because they aren't as effective at their jobs or having trouble with their relationships. They may be late for appointments, forget vital medication or skip important meetings.
